Provide actual methods for checking if the ACPI support thinks the cable is
80wire, or doesn't know

 /**
+ * ata_acpi_cbl_80wire         -       Check for 80 wire cable
+ * @ap: Port to check
+ *
+ * Return 1 if the ACPI mode data for this port indicates the BIOS selected
+ * an 80wire mode.
+ */
+
+int ata_acpi_cbl_80wire(struct ata_port *ap)
+{
+       struct ata_acpi_gtm gtm;
+       int valid = 0;
+
+       /* No _GTM data, no information */
+       if (ata_acpi_gtm(ap, &gtm) < 0)
+               return 0;
+
+       /* Split timing, DMA enabled */
+       if ((gtm.flags & 0x11) == 0x11 && gtm.drive[0].dma < 55)
+               valid |= 1;
+       if ((gtm.flags & 0x14) == 0x14 && gtm.drive[1].dma < 55)
+               valid |= 2;
+       /* Shared timing, DMA enabled */
+       if ((gtm.flags & 0x11) == 0x01 && gtm.drive[0].dma < 55)
+               valid |= 1;
+       if ((gtm.flags & 0x14) == 0x04 && gtm.drive[0].dma < 55)
+               valid |= 2;
+
+       /* Drive check */
+       if ((valid & 1) && ata_dev_enabled(&ap->device[0]))
+               return 1;
+       if ((valid & 2) && ata_dev_enabled(&ap->device[1]))
+               return 1;
+       return 0;
+}
+
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ata_acpi_cbl_80wire);
